WebAug 24, 2024 · AREDS1 showed that 15 milligrams (mg) of beta carotene, 500 mg of vitamin C, 400 IU of vitamin E, 80 mg of zinc oxide, and 2 mg of cupric oxide reduced the risk of disease progression. AREDS2 tested the substitution of 10 mg of lutein and 2 mg of zeaxanthin for beta carotene. Web1 day ago · Unfortunately, Tylenol may not be the best idea.
